A drama series currently airing in one of the major broadcast networks is supposedly killing off its star when the ongoing season comes to an end, reported TVLine.

According to the website, the emotional death scene will occur toward the end of the episode and there will be a cemetery scene. The "star" hasn't been officially released from his/her contract. However, an insider said: "As it stands now, [redacted] is not returning next season."

This blind item from TVLine has sparked a lot of discussion on who would die and who deserves to die. A majority of fans believe the show mentioned in the article is "Castle" and Stana Katic's Beckett would be the one to go.

However, Katic has not been signed on for next year and therefore has no contract to be released from. Also, "Castle" is yet to be officially renewed.

The cast of "The Good Wife" can be ruled out as the show is coming to an end with Season 7. Similarly, the leads of "Bones," too, appear to be safe.

According to one section of fans, Robin Hood from "Once Upon a Time" seems to be the one hinted at in the TVLine article.

"Not sure but I heard there was a picture of Robin Hood's grave in 'Once Upon a Time' with Regina dressed in black in front of it. I haven't seen the pic though," noted one fan, while another pointed out the show recently filmed a funeral scene and Regina was spotted saying goodbye to someone.

Robin Hood is portrayed by British actor Sean Maguire, and rumours swirling around suggest he will soon leave the show.

When TVLine questioned the actor about his rumoured departure from the show, Maguire did not give a definite answer. However, he did note things are going to get dark and scary on "Once Upon a Time."

"We're going to the Underworld, so I don't expect much good stuff is going to happen! But as to where it's going to lead [for Robin], I can't say," he said. "There are obstacles everywhere — a lot of bad people from the past are coming back and they are not too happy with our heroes. If 'Once Upon a Time' was the 'Star Wars' franchise, this would be Empire Strikes Back. It's going to get dark, it's going to be scary, and there will be surprises."
